Jefferson Turf Conditions

Jefferson's Jackson County clay soil is dense and doesn't drain like sandy loam—that's actually why artificial turf is such a smart choice here. Natural grass struggles with water pooling and compaction in our clay, but quality synthetic turf with proper base preparation and drainage wins every time. Most Jefferson properties get a solid mix of sun and shade, especially if you're in the Downtown Jefferson area or near established neighborhoods in Pendergrass. We assess your yard's sun exposure carefully because that affects turf selection and performance. Afternoon shade is actually a bonus in Georgia summers. Typical Jefferson yards range from modest urban lots to larger suburban properties, so we've installed everything from compact 200-square-foot chipping areas to full backyard greens. Our installation process accounts for Jackson County's clay by creating a solid, permeable base layer that prevents standing water and ensures years of playability. If you're in a community with HOA guidelines, synthetic turf almost always gets approval—it's green, maintained, and doesn't require chemicals or constant upkeep. We handle all the grading and drainage work so your green performs perfectly, rain or shine.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does artificial turf handle Jefferson's clay soil and drainage?

Clay soil in Jackson County doesn't absorb water well, but that's exactly why we install a engineered base layer beneath the turf. We create proper slope and drainage channels so water moves away from the green instead of pooling. Your putting surface stays playable after rain, and we've never had a Jefferson installation deal with standing water issues. It's a huge upgrade compared to fighting natural grass in clay.

Will a putting green work in the shade around Downtown Jefferson and Pendergrass?

Absolutely. Many Jefferson properties have mature trees that create afternoon shade—that's actually ideal for synthetic turf. Unlike natural grass, our turf doesn't need sunlight to stay green and healthy. We choose the right turf blend for your specific sun-shade pattern, so whether your yard gets dappled shade or full afternoon coverage, your green will look perfect and perform great.

How long does installation take, and will it disrupt my yard?

Most Jefferson putting greens take 2–4 days from start to finish, depending on size and base prep. We handle all the heavy lifting—grading, compacting, installing drainage, and laying turf—so you're not managing the project. Your yard is ready to putt by day four.
